  The Mainstays is based in Kalamazoo and for its debut, the band has made a self-titled album. Three-fifths of the group are alumni of the band Funktion and this sounds, not surprisingly, like a Funktion release.  Singer/songwriter, Andrew Schrock's distinctive vocals are what gives it away; but the placid R&B sound is similar as well. The Mainstays is an album of light neo-soul that doesn't demand much of its audience.       Rebecca Ruth
